Universal Security Instruments Reports First-Quarter Results
OWINGS MILLS, MD, August 12, 2009 – Universal Security Instruments, Inc. (NYSE Amex: UUU) today announced results for its fiscal first quarter ended June 30, 2009.
The Owings Mills, MD-based designer and marketer of safety and security equipment reported its net income rose for the quarter to $611,465, or $0.25 per basic and diluted share, from $403,480, or $0.16 per basic and diluted share, for the comparable quarter last year. Sales for its first quarter were $5,914,905 compared to $6,192,801 for last year. Results for the first quarter of 2009 include an increase in the Company’s Hong Kong Joint Venture earnings of $428,335. Included in this increase is the recognition by the Company of a $246,180 gain on intercompany sales of inventory from prior periods which, in accordance with GAAP, may only be recognized as income upon sales by the Company to customers, and a gain on currency holdings of $117,050. Included in last year’s results was a charge of $53,659 from discontinued operations.
"We are cautiously optimistic that the housing market has turned the corner and demand for our USI Electric line of products has stabilized at lower levels. At the same time, we continue to increase market share in the retail segment of our operation. We are very pleased with the results from our first quarter, especially during this difficult and challenging operating environment. We also have been highly focused on strengthening our balance sheet, while aggressively pursuing new opportunities,” said CEO, Harvey Grossblatt.
UNIVERSAL SECURITY INSTRUMENTS, INC. is a U.S.-based manufacturer (through its Hong Kong Joint Venture) and distributor of safety and security devices. Founded in 1969, the Company has a 40-year heritage of developing innovative and easy-to-install products, including smoke, fire and carbon monoxide alarms.
